Date photograph taken: 19 July 2004
Date built: 2003-2004
Architect: Proctor and Matthews

A bold colour statement, the other side is also brightly coloured, in shades of brown. This is part of the re-development of the old cattle market site, and is situated on the other side of a large square from a leisure centre.

Proctor and Matthews were the "concept" architects for the hotel (i.e. responsible for the overall design) and CMC Architects were the "executive" architects (i.e. responsible for the build).

Although located only a couple of hundred meters as the crow flies from the railway station (a natural source of customers), the actual transport connection to the station is rather long-winded, by foot or vehicle, although that might improve in future.
